[status] Don?t you just hate rain squalls! The stronger wind they bring means you?ve got to have less sail up, then in the lull they leave behind them you wallow with floppy sails.
Last night we resigned ourselves to just using the motor in the lulls until the wind returned. Many cycles of sail, motor-sail, plus adjusting the sails often. One hardly has time to read ones book ?
We?ve been spoiled for most of this trip by really steady winds so the contrast is quite stark. On the plus side it?s getting much warmer now which maybe means you get more squalls in the more tropical conditions?
Anyway making good progress, we just have to work for it a bit harder than expected.
